What you will learn

✓ The 70:20:10 framework
Understand this foundational model not as a rigid formula, but as a guide for creating a balanced learning ecosystem that prioritizes experience and social learning.

✓ A new mindset
Shift your focus from delivering content to enabling performance by creating environments that foster psychological safety and rich, contextual conversations, and a focus on performance improvement.

✓ Designing for impact
Learn how to design solutions that address specific business challenges, from compliance and diversity training to building expertise in any domain, in a way that engages individuals and leads to measurable behavioral change.

✓ The L&D business case
Get equipped with the arguments and evidence you need to explain the value of collaborative, experience-based learning to senior stakeholders who just want to see results.

Charles Jennings

Charles Jennings is a leading thinker in innovative learning and performance approaches. An author and well-known speaker, he is particularly known for his work on the integration of learning and working.

His career includes roles as a business school professor, as head of the UK national centre for
networked learning, as an executive and Chief Learning Officer in global companies, and as a member of advisory boards for international learning, performance, and business bodies.
